Our Review

The Midea MRB19B7 19 cu. ft. Bottom Freezer is a 18.7 cu. ft. bottom-freezer refrigerator from Midea, sitting in the sub-$1,000 range. With a 13.3 cu. ft. fresh-food compartment and 5.4 cu. ft. of freezer space, it's positioned for couples and small families.

What stands out

At this price, Midea delivers the headline specs (capacity, ice maker, ENERGY STAR rating where present) and skips the extras. If you need a working refrigerator and don't care about cabinet-flush styling or app integration, that's a fair trade.

Layout and capacity

Exterior dimensions are 29.5" W × 66.6" H × 32.0" D — check your opening, especially the depth with handles extended. Total useable capacity is 18.7 cu. ft., split 13.3 fresh / 5.4 freezer.

Bottom line

The Midea MRB19B7 19 cu. ft. Bottom Freezer delivers the basics at one of the lowest prices in the category. If your goal is a working fridge with the right capacity, this gets the job done.
